R902 ORC is a 1998 Renault Kangoo in Yellow with a 1,870c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 10 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 1998 Renault Kangoo models, the average MOT pass rate is 61.5% with a typical mileage of 107,393 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Renault Kangoo f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 86,705 recorded failures. If you're considering buying R902 ORC,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Renault Kangoo typically stays on UK roads for around 28 years. At 28 years old, this Renault Kangoo is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
